Watch: Tim David Appears to Challenge Usman Tariq’s Bowling Action During The Hundred

Pakistan spinner Usman Tariq’s unconventional bowling action once again came under the spotlight after Australia batter Tim David appeared to question its legality following his dismissal during The Hundred.

The incident took place during Trent Rockets’ clash against Birmingham Phoenix when David edged a fuller delivery outside off stump from Tariq to the wicketkeeper. Moments after being dismissed, the Australian all-rounder was seen speaking with the umpire and appeared to suggest that the delivery should have been called a no-ball due to concerns over Tariq’s bowling action.

David also briefly gestured as though he wanted to review the dismissal before deciding against it. However, with the on-field umpire satisfied that the delivery was legal, the wicket stood and play continued.

The incident has once again drawn attention to Tariq’s bowling action, which has been under scrutiny in both domestic and international cricket over the past few years.

According to MCC Law 21.2, a delivery is deemed fair provided the bowler does not throw the ball. Once the bowling arm reaches shoulder height during the delivery stride, the elbow must not be partially or completely straightened before the ball is released. The striker’s-end umpire is primarily responsible for judging the legality of a delivery, although the bowler’s-end umpire also has the authority to call a no-ball if they believe the ball has been thrown.

David’s reaction suggested he believed Tariq’s delivery breached those laws, but the umpire did not agree and allowed the wicket to stand.

This is not the first time Tariq’s bowling action has sparked debate. During the 2024 Pakistan Super League (PSL), on-field umpires Asif Yaqoob and Richard Illingworth reported the spinner for a suspect bowling action. His action came under scrutiny again during the 2025 PSL, when he was once more reported by the match officials.

Earlier this year, another Australian batter, Cameron Green, also appeared to question Tariq’s action during the second T20I against Pakistan. After being dismissed by the spinner, Green mimicked a baseball-style throwing motion, a gesture widely interpreted as a reference to Tariq’s unusual bowling action.

Although there was no indication from the match officials during The Hundred that Tariq’s latest spell breached the laws of the game, Tim David’s visible reaction has once again reignited the debate over the Pakistan spinner’s bowling action. With previous reports already on record, Tariq’s action is likely to remain under close scrutiny whenever he takes the field.
